Maislabyrinth Erfurt is a large seasonal leisure ground in Erfurt, Thüringen, combining a timed-entry corn maze with a beer garden, beach lounge (volleyball, table tennis, chess), and a full events calendar of concerts and open-air festivals. The 2026 maze season runs 8 July to 20 September, Wednesday to Sunday, with free general site access outside maze entry and special events.

The egapark, Erfurt's large botanical exhibition garden, stages an annual 'Kürbiszeit' pumpkin show with more than 50,000 pumpkins built into large sculptures (2026 theme: 'Unter dem Meer', an underwater world). The 2026 pumpkin exhibition runs 5 September to 31 October, Tuesday to Sunday, within the park's general daily opening hours; the park also has a playground, observation tower, and museum.

Het Riesenkürbisfest bij het Strandbad (strand aan het meer) in Breitungen/Werra, Thüringen, staat bekend als het grootste pompoenfestival van de regio. Het festival bevat een weegwedstrijd voor reuzenpompoenen en races met pompoenboten op het meer. De editie van 2026 staat gepland voor 12–13 september en wordt georganiseerd door de Gemeinde Breitungen.
Hirschs Maislabyrinth in Oettersdorf, near Schleiz in the Saale-Orla-Kreis, Thüringen, is a roughly 30,000 sqm corn maze with a new theme each year, run by local families and clubs who also sell refreshments and pre-order Christmas geese. The operator's own website has not been updated since around 2019–2020, so current operating status for 2026 is unconfirmed.
